How To Fix /PM0/ALB_MESSAGES224 - An abstract benefit right occurs twice for one coverage component type


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/PM0/ALB_MESSAGES -

  • Message number: 224

  • Message text: An abstract benefit right occurs twice for one coverage component type

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/PM0/ALB_MESSAGES224 - An abstract benefit right occurs twice for one coverage component type ?

    The SAP error message /PM0/ALB_MESSAGES224 indicates that there is a duplication of an abstract benefit right for a specific coverage component type in the system. This typically occurs in the context of benefits management or insurance-related modules within SAP, where benefit rights are defined for various coverage components.

    Cause:

    1. Duplicate Entries: The most common cause of this error is that the same abstract benefit right has been assigned multiple times to the same coverage component type. This can happen due to incorrect configuration or data entry.
    2. Configuration Issues: There may be issues in the configuration of the benefit rights or coverage components, leading to overlaps or duplications.
    3. Data Migration Issues: If data has been migrated from another system, it is possible that duplicates were introduced during the migration process.

    Solution:

    1. Check Configuration: Review the configuration settings for the benefit rights and coverage components in the SAP system. Ensure that each abstract benefit right is uniquely assigned to a coverage component type.
    2. Identify Duplicates: Use transaction codes like SE16 or SE11 to query the relevant tables (e.g., T5A0A, T5A0B) to identify any duplicate entries for the abstract benefit rights.
    3. Remove Duplicates: If duplicates are found, remove or correct the duplicate entries to ensure that each coverage component type has a unique abstract benefit right.
    4. Data Validation: Implement data validation checks to prevent the entry of duplicate benefit rights in the future.
    5.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to benefits management for any specific guidelines or best practices.
